Langley Enterprises pays a constant dividend of $0.85 a share. Calculate the annual dividend payout if an investor owns 100 shares.

1 Answer

4 votes

Final answer:

The annual dividend payout for an investor owning 100 shares in Langley Enterprises, which pays a constant dividend of $0.85 per share, would be $85.

Step-by-step explanation:

To calculate the annual dividend payout, you multiply the constant dividend per share by the number of shares owned. In this case, the constant dividend is $0.85 and the investor owns 100 shares. Therefore, the annual dividend payout would be $0.85 x 100 = $85.
